wiki.sine.space | sinespace

Difference between revisions of "Scripting/SEmbeddedVideo"

From wiki.sine.space
Jump to: navigation, search
m
m
Line 8: Line 8:
 
</pre>}}
 
</pre>}}
  
{{ScriptFunction|void|Play()|If URL is set, plays the video|5=<pre>
+
{{ScriptFunction|void|Play|()|If URL is set, plays the video|5=<pre>
  
 
Space.Host.ExecutingObject.EmbeddedVideo.Play()
 
Space.Host.ExecutingObject.EmbeddedVideo.Play()
 
</pre>}}
 
</pre>}}
  
{{ScriptFunction|void|Stop()|Stops the playback|5=<pre>
+
{{ScriptFunction|void|Stop|()|Stops the playback|5=<pre>
 
Space.Host.ExecutingObject.EmbeddedVideo.Stop()
 
Space.Host.ExecutingObject.EmbeddedVideo.Stop()
 
</pre>}}
 
</pre>}}
  
{{ScriptFunction|void|Pause()|Pauses currently played video|5=<pre>
+
{{ScriptFunction|void|Pause|()|Pauses currently played video|5=<pre>
 
Space.Host.ExecutingObject.EmbeddedVideo.Pause()
 
Space.Host.ExecutingObject.EmbeddedVideo.Pause()
 
</pre>}}
 
</pre>}}
  
{{ScriptFunction|void|Resume()|If the video is currently paused, it will resume playback|5=<pre>
+
{{ScriptFunction|void|Resume|()|If the video is currently paused, it will resume playback|5=<pre>
 
Space.Host.ExecutingObject.EmbeddedVideo.Resume()
 
Space.Host.ExecutingObject.EmbeddedVideo.Resume()
 
</pre>}}
 
</pre>}}
  
{{ScriptFunction|void|SynchorizeUrl ()|Synchorize current video url|5=<pre>
+
{{ScriptFunction|void|SynchorizeUrl|()|Synchorize current video url|5=<pre>
 
Space.Host.ExecutingObject.EmbeddedVideo.SynchorizeUrl()
 
Space.Host.ExecutingObject.EmbeddedVideo.SynchorizeUrl()
 
</pre>}}
 
</pre>}}
  
{{ScriptFunction|void|ClearRenderTexture()|Clears the Render Texture|5=<pre>
+
{{ScriptFunction|void|ClearRenderTexture|()|Clears the Render Texture|5=<pre>
 
Space.Host.ExecutingObject.EmbeddedVideo.ClearRenderTexture()
 
Space.Host.ExecutingObject.EmbeddedVideo.ClearRenderTexture()
 
</pre>}}
 
</pre>}}

Revision as of 05:09, 12 May 2021

OnStateChange

void OnStateChange ()

Binds a function to the OnStateChange event which fires every time player changes its state


function sc()
Space.Log("State Changed")
end

Space.Host.ExecutingObject.EmbeddedVideo.OnStateChange(sc)


Play

void Play ()

If URL is set, plays the video


Space.Host.ExecutingObject.EmbeddedVideo.Play()


Stop

void Stop ()

Stops the playback

Space.Host.ExecutingObject.EmbeddedVideo.Stop()


Pause

void Pause ()

Pauses currently played video

Space.Host.ExecutingObject.EmbeddedVideo.Pause()


Resume

void Resume ()

If the video is currently paused, it will resume playback

Space.Host.ExecutingObject.EmbeddedVideo.Resume()


SynchorizeUrl

void SynchorizeUrl ()

Synchorize current video url

Space.Host.ExecutingObject.EmbeddedVideo.SynchorizeUrl()


ClearRenderTexture

void ClearRenderTexture ()

Clears the Render Texture

Space.Host.ExecutingObject.EmbeddedVideo.ClearRenderTexture()






Property

void Property { get;set; }

xxxxxxxxxx